The four-hour mechanical shaking process is a critical pharmaceutical extraction step designed to ensure that the Etodolac active ingredient is fully released from its complex polymer matrix. By applying continuous shear force and physical agitation, the shaker forces the patch matrix to swell and dissolve, allowing the drug to migrate completely into the phosphate buffer for precise quantitative measurement.
This rigorous extraction protocol is essential for verifying drug loading accuracy, ensuring that every manufactured batch meets stringent GMP potency standards and provides consistent therapeutic delivery for enterprise-level distribution.
The Science of Matrix Extraction
Overcoming the Polymer Backbone Barrier
Etodolac transdermal patches utilize a sophisticated polymer backbone to control drug release over time. During testing, this same matrix can trap the drug, making it difficult to measure the total content without high-energy mechanical intervention.
The four-hour shaking period provides sufficient time for the phosphate buffer solution to penetrate the matrix. This causes the polymer to fully swell or dissolve, freeing the Etodolac molecules that would otherwise remain sequestered.
Accelerating Diffusion through Shear Force
Mechanical shakers provide continuous reciprocating or rotational movement that creates constant shear force. This kinetic energy significantly accelerates the diffusion of the drug from the patch into the solvent phase.
Without this sustained agitation, the extraction would be incomplete or inconsistent. The four-hour window ensures that the drug reaches a uniform concentration in the solvent, which is a prerequisite for accurate UV spectrophotometry.

Preparing Samples for Quantitative Analysis
Once the shaking process is complete, the solution is filtered to remove any insoluble polymer residues. This ensures that the remaining liquid is a clear, representative sample of the drug’s total concentration.
This clean sample is then analyzed using UV spectrophotometry. Because the mechanical shaker ensured 100% extraction, the resulting data provides a definitive confirmation of the patch's stability and dosage accuracy.
Understanding the Trade-offs
The Risk of Shortened Extraction Times
Reducing the shaking time below the validated four-hour threshold often leads to incomplete extraction. This results in data that suggests the patch is under-dosed, potentially leading to the unnecessary rejection of high-quality batches.
Potential for API Degradation
While high-frequency vibration is necessary, excessive energy or heat—such as that produced by some ultrasonic methods—can occasionally degrade sensitive active ingredients. A calibrated mechanical shaker offers a balance of high-energy input without the thermal risks associated with alternative methods.
Equipment and Solvent Compatibility
The success of this four-hour process depends heavily on using the correct phosphate buffer solution. If the solvent is not properly matched to the polymer's solubility profile, even extended shaking will fail to yield a representative sample.
